The Good

  • High RTP Rates: Many video poker games offer RTP rates upwards of 97%, particularly in popular variants like Jacks or Better.
  • Strategic Gameplay: Players have control over their decisions, allowing for strategic thinking that can influence outcomes.
  • Variety of Games: Numerous versions exist, including Deuces Wild, Joker Poker, and more, providing players with options based on their preferences.
  • Bonuses and Promotions: Online casinos often provide bonuses specifically for video poker, enhancing the potential for profit.

The Bad

  • Wagering Requirements: Bonuses often come with high wagering requirements (e.g., 35x), making it challenging to convert bonus money into cash.
  • Learning Curve: While the mechanics are simple, mastering optimal strategies can take time and practice.
  • Variance Across Games: Different video poker variants have varying volatility levels, impacting your bankroll and playing experience.

The Ugly

  • House Edge: Some variants can have a higher house edge, particularly if played with suboptimal strategies—up to 5% in certain cases.
  • Potential for Addiction: The fast-paced nature of online video poker may lead to increased risk of gambling addiction for some players.
  • Comparison of Variants: Not all games are created equal, and players may find themselves losing more on certain less popular variants.
Video Poker VariantRTP (%)House Edge (%)Volatility
Jacks or Better99.540.46Low
Deuces Wild100.76-0.76Medium
Joker Poker97.302.70High
